President of Cuba completes an intense day of work in the Russian Federation
The First Secretary of the Central Committee of the Communist Party of Cuba and President of the Republic, Miguel Díaz-Canel, completed an intense work durin his visit to the Russian Federation. .
In the first activity in Moscow, the president paid tribute to the historical leader of the Cuban Revolution, Fidel Castro Ruz (1926-2016), and placed a wreath before the monument that perpetuates his memory, in the square that bears his name in the Sokol neighborhood.
Previously, Díaz-Canel held a brief meeting with members of the Cuban state mission in the Eurasian nation.
